How Does Zhengping Wu's Compensation Compare With Similar Sized Companies?

According to our data, China Greenland Broad Greenstate Group Company Limited has a market capitalization of HK$1.6b, and pays its CEO total annual compensation worth CN¥1.1m. (This number is for the twelve months until December 2018). While this analysis focuses on total compensation, it's worth noting the salary is lower, valued at CN¥960k. We looked at a group of companies with market capitalizations from CN¥706m to CN¥2.8b, and the median CEO total compensation was CN¥2.0m.

A first glance this seems like a real positive for shareholders, since Zhengping Wu is paid less than the average total compensation paid by similar sized companies. However, before we heap on the praise, we should delve deeper to understand business performance.

Is China Greenland Broad Greenstate Group Company Limited Growing?

Over the last three years China Greenland Broad Greenstate Group Company Limited has shrunk its earnings per share by an average of 18% per year (measured with a line of best fit). In the last year, its revenue is down -33%.

Sadly for shareholders, earnings per share are actually down, over three years. This is compounded by the fact revenue is actually down on last year. These factors suggest that the business performance wouldn't really justify a high pay packet for the CEO.

Has China Greenland Broad Greenstate Group Company Limited Been A Good Investment?

Given the total loss of 57% over three years, many shareholders in China Greenland Broad Greenstate Group Company Limited are probably rather dissatisfied, to say the least. It therefore might be upsetting for shareholders if the CEO were paid generously.

In Summary...

It looks like China Greenland Broad Greenstate Group Company Limited pays its CEO less than similar sized companies.

Shareholders should note that compensation for Zhengping Wu is under the median of a group of similar sized companies. But then, EPS growth is lacking and so are the returns to shareholders. Considering all these factors, we'd stop short of saying the CEO pay is too high, but we don't think shareholders would want to see a pay rise before business performance improves.
